About 1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ide
1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ide (PubChem CID 55633427) has the molecular formula C17H21Cl2N3O3
and a molecular weight of 386.28 g/mol. Its IUPAC name is 1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ide.

What is the SMILES notation for 1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ide?
The canonical SMILES for 1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ide is CCNC(=O)CNC(=O)C1CCCN(C(=O)c2ccc(Cl)c(Cl)c2)C1.
What is the InChIKey of 1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ide?
The InChIKey is VYJYMHFKBAMAPA-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H21Cl2N3O3/c1-2-20-15(23)9-21-16(24)12-4-3-7-22(10-12)17(25)11-5-6-13(18)14(19)8-11/h5-6,8,12H,2-4,7,9-10H2,1H3,(H,20,23)(H,21,24).
What are the key properties of 1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ide?
1-(3,4-dichlorobenzoyl)-N-[2-(ethylamino)-2-oxoethyl]piperidine-3-carboxamide has a molecular weight of 386.28 g/mol, XLogP of 2.10, 5 rotatable bonds, 2 hydrogen bond donors, and 3 hydrogen bond acceptors.
